Chumley Posted November 24, 2009 Share Posted November 24, 2009 For a nice quick task I would kill the baby black's in the chaos tunnels. If you decide you want to tackle the adults then I would head to the evil chicken lair that is accessed via Zanaris. Range is a good option here and finding a safespot is easy.
